Letter carriers to pick up donations
On May 12, letter carriers will pick up donated food for low-income families in Santa Clara County. The national food drive is sponsored by the National Association of Letter Carriers, AFL-CIO Community Service, the postal service, United Way, Campbell's Soup and Saturn.
Residents should leave nonperishable food by their mailbox on the morning of May 12. Most needed foods include peanut butter, fruit juices, cereal, powdered milk and canned goods.
Council appoints new commissioner
Saratoga City Council appointed Mike Garakani to the planning commission on May 2, bringing to six the number of active commissioners on the board.
City code stipulates that the commission must operate with seven commissioners, though four qualify as a legal quorum.
Former Planning Commission Chairman Chuck Page recently withdrew his application for another term on the commission, leaving the city without another candidate for the seventh seat.
Garakani's term will expire in April 2005.
